Class AmazonPayConfigurationController
Class AdminHttpViewController
This class contains some helper methods for handling view requests. Be careful always when outputting raw user data to HTML or when handling POST requests because insufficient protection will lead to XSS and CSRF vulnerabilities.
- HttpViewController implements HttpViewControllerInterface
-
AdminHttpViewController
implements
AdminStatusOnlyInterface
-
AmazonPayConfigurationController
Category: System
Link: http://en.wikipedia.org/wiki/Cross-site_scripting
Link: http://en.wikipedia.org/wiki/Cross-site_request_forgery
Implements: HttpViewControllerInterface
Located at Controllers/HttpView/Admin/AmazonPayConfigurationController.inc.php
Methods summary
public
|
#
proceed(
Processes a http response object which is get by invoking an action method. The action method is determined by the http context reader instance and the current request context. Re-implement this method in child classes to enable XSS and CSRF protection on demand. |
public
|
#
actionDefault( )
Default action method. Every controller child class requires at least the default action method, which is invoked when the ::_getQueryParameterData('do') value is not separated by a trailing slash. |
public
|
|
public
array|boolean|
|
|
public
|
|
protected
array
|
#
getOrdersStatuses( )
Retrieves a array of order statuses (IDs and names as per current session language) |
Methods inherited from AdminHttpViewController
Methods inherited from HttpViewController
__construct(),
_callActionMethod(),
_getPostData(),
_getPostDataCollection(),
_getQueryParameter(),
_getQueryParametersCollection(),
_getServerData(),
_render(),
_validatePageToken(),
getTemplateFile()
Properties inherited from HttpViewController
$assets,
$contentView,
$httpContextReader,
$httpResponseProcessor,
$postDataArray,
$queryParametersArray,
$serverDataArray